About Leslie Lodge

Upmarket B&B in the heart of one of Blantyre's quiet neighbourhoods
Named after the birthplace of David Livingstone, busy Blantyre is an appealing city that's one of the oldest in East Africa. If you're looking for a place to stay here, book your space at Leslie Lodge, a charming home-from-home base in the leafy suburb of Mount Pleasant, near the city centre. A really good option for people travelling through the city for work or holidays, Leslie Lodge has developed a reputation as a very comfortable, clean guesthouse. The power is reliable, the water is hot, the beer is cold, the grounds are immaculate, and the owners and staff are caring.

Property details

The property

Beautifully tended tropical gardens and an attractive neighbourhood cocoon this large-windowed house. Indoors, a small inviting lounge area lies beside a simple, bright restaurant area with views through the windows of the gardens. (Breakfasts are included; evening meals must be ordered beforehand.) Outside, a tiled courtyard surrounded by greenery shelters a swimming pool that is perfect for cooling off in the summer heat.

The rooms

Of the 12 spacious twin or double guest suites, 10 offer optional self-catering facilities. Each is individually decorated in bright shades and simple patterned fabrics – the ambience throughout is calm and comfortably modern. The standard minibar is there to be dipped into, there's internet access and satellite TV. Each room also has its own private patio, perfect for relaxing in the sun or getting on with work.

Activities

Blantyre offers a host of attractions. It's worth exploring the city centre's great shops and paying a visit to the Museum of Malawi (or Chichiri Museum) for an injection of local culture. The Blantyre sports club is open to those willing to pay an entrance fee, and there you can find plenty of activities like tennis and swimming. Arrange a mountain-biking adventure, and get the. local vibe at Al Pacino's Bar. Feeling energetic? Climb Ndirande Mountain for some incredible views.
